mirror of
https://gitlab.freedesktop.org/gstreamer/gstreamer.git
synced 2024-07-05 22:25:55 +00:00
basesrc: fix caps leak
This commit is contained in:
parent
72f3c7c7a3
commit
4b79582925
|
@ -2855,6 +2855,9 @@ gst_base_src_negotiate (GstBaseSrc * basesrc)
|
||||||
caps = gst_pad_get_current_caps (basesrc->srcpad);
|
caps = gst_pad_get_current_caps (basesrc->srcpad);
|
||||||
|
|
||||||
result = gst_base_src_prepare_allocation (basesrc, caps);
|
result = gst_base_src_prepare_allocation (basesrc, caps);
|
||||||
|
|
||||||
|
if (caps)
|
||||||
|
gst_caps_unref (caps);
|
||||||
}
|
}
|
||||||
return result;
|
return result;
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in a new issue